CMS 5-Star Ratings
CMS rates every Medicare/Medicaid-certified nursing home on four domains. The Overall rating is driven primarily by Health Inspection results, then adjusted up or down by Staffing and Quality Measures.
Staffing & Workforce
Direct-care staffing is the strongest operational driver of quality in nursing homes. Values are hours per resident per day, derived from payroll-based journal (PBJ) submissions. "Case-mix" adjusts for resident acuity; "Adjusted" is the CMS rating-input value.
| Role | Reported | Case-mix expected | Adjusted | Federal floor |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Total nurse All nursing staff combined: RN + LPN + Aide | 3.82 | 3.15 | 4.68 | ≥ 3.48 | |
| Registered Nurse (RN) Licensed RN hours. Strongest driver of clinical outcomes. | 0.18 | 0.55 | 0.22 | ≥ 0.55 | Below floor |
|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N) LPN/LVN hours. Often handles medication administration. | 1.16 | 0.70 | 1.42 | — | |
| Nurse aide CNA hours. Bulk of direct resident care — bathing, feeding, mobility. | 2.48 | 1.90 | 3.04 | — | |
| Licensed (RN + LPN) Combined licensed nurse coverage. | 1.34 | — | — | — | |
| Physical therapist Rehabilitation therapist hours — important for post-acute / rehab admissions. | 0.01 | — | — | — |
Federal minimums (phasing in under the CMS 2024 minimum staffing rule) shown for reference. RN: 0.55 hrs/resident/day. Total nurse: 3.48 hrs/resident/day.

Health Inspections
CMS weights three inspection cycles to compute the Health Inspection rating: the most recent (50%), the second most recent (33%), and the oldest (17%). Each standard-survey deficiency is assigned a score based on scope and severity; complaint-survey findings and revisit scores are added to produce the cycle total.
